All across the humanities fields there is a new interest in materials and materiality. This is the first book to capture and study the ldquo;material turnrdquo; in the humanities from all its varied perspectives. Cultural Histories of the Material World brings together top scholars from all these different fieldsmdash;from Art History; Anthropology; Archaeology; Classics; Folklore; History; History of Science; Literature; Philosophymdash;to offer their vision of what cultural history of the material world looks like and attempt to show how attention to materiality can contribute to a more precise historical understanding of specific times; places; ways; and means. The result is a spectacular kaleidoscope of future possibilities and new perspectives.
